Atlanta Wedding Photographer Shares Map of Roswell Georgia Best Wedding Venues
North of Atlanta there is the historic downtown Roswell, where there are some of the best historic wedding venues in the United States. The main road going through town and most of the buildings have been untouched for over a hundred years.  It will take you back in time and give your wedding a touch of grandeur. 
The crown jewel and my favorite of the venues in the area is Naylor Hall.  Naylor was built in 1840 by the founder of Roswell Barrington King for H.W. Proudfoot, and his wife.  Proudfoot was the bookkeeper at Roswell Mill, the anchor business of the town.  In the 1930’s Colonel Harrison Broadwell purchased the property and named it Naylor Hall in honor of his wife’s family.  The Colonel added many of the improvements that you can still see today such as the large columns, the handcrafted woodwork, and the large porticos encompassing the original structure. Finally, the property was purchased by Sunny Bailey 30 years ago.  She had the vision and fortitude to transform this historic landmark to the wedding venue it is today.  They have the best staff in the business with Abbey at the helm.  Please stop by and see how they can help your vision come true. 
Primrose Cottage is owned by Magic Moments and A Divine Event.  Primrose Cottage was also built by Roswell King for his daughter.  It has a stately lawn and garden in the back for your wedding ceremony.  The interior has a luxurious Bridal Suite with ample room for your bridal party and make up team.  Also, upstairs is a balcony that overlooks the garden and the entrance to the large ballroom downstairs.  The Ballroom has hardwood floors and floor to ceiling windows with a picture window to the English garden.   It is a venue swimming in charm. 
Roswell Mill Club / Ivy Hall are located by the ruins of the Roswell Mill.  Both facilities overlook Vickery Creek, and ar perfect for outdoor ceremonies and cocktails in the evening hours.  Within Ivy Hall there is 25,000 square feet (about four times the area of a basketball court) of deck overlooking Vickery Creek where you can hear the soothing rush of the water below.  There are floor to ceiling windows making for a scenic view of the park and a covered bridge.   
Roswell Historic Hall is the old library. Itl was eloquently preserved, featuring dramatic high ceilings, exposed beams, original brick walls, and a grand open loft that will enhance any occasion. A newly remodeled event venue with both a historic look and feel as well as a luxurious one, Roswell Historic Hall is a unique place for your next special event. Whether you bring your own vendors, shop à la carte with their Partial Package, or take advantage of their Full Package of professional services, you have come to the right place. By customizing each event, your celebration at Roswell Historic Hall will truly be one of a kind.

3 Most Common Mistakes Brides Make When Shopping for the Wedding Dress
Wedding dress shopping can be an overwhelming experience for majority of the brides-to-be as they do not have experience of buying a wedding gown.
While every girl fantasizes about finding the ‘right’ dress for her wedding, not everyone is lucky enough to find the dress easily that would turn heads on her BIG DAY. However, wedding dress shopping can be made easier.
How?

To help you in the process of finding the perfect wedding gown, we are highlighting the most common mistakes brides make while dress shopping. So, make sure you don’t make them or they will affect your big day.
1.    Buying the Dress Too Early
Majority of the brides-to-be get super excited with the idea of tying the knot and the first thing they do is to order their wedding dress, without taking into account the fact that there is still too much time left in the ceremony.
Ordering the wedding gown before finalizing the kind of wedding one is going to have, the weather at the time of wedding, venue and theme is one of the biggest mistakes brides make, according to the pros. Also, there is a likelihood that the bridal dress trends may change by the time of your wedding and the last thing a girl wants on her wedding is wearing an out-of-fashion gown.
2.    Taking Too Many People with Them
While both brides and their friends and family members are excited for the wedding and want to be a part of your wedding dress shopping journey, taking too many people is one of the worst mistakes you could make. Even if you have hired a (LIMO) to go for the meeting with the designer, take only few people with you. Remember, more people mean more opinions and more confusion. Everyone has a different taste so, only take those few people who you know have a good fashion sense.
3.    Not Being Open Minded
A lot of brides go for the dress shopping with a specific design and/or cut in mind and then stick to it without even considering their body shape, comfort and practicality. While it’s good to have an idea about the kind of overall look you want, keep your mind open to designer’s suggestions and recommendations. There is no harm in trying out a different cut or design.
